Ricardo Valerdi is a scholar working on Control and Systems Engineering, Information Systems and Safety, Risk, Reliability and Quality. According to data from OpenAlex, Ricardo Valerdi has authored 75 papers receiving a total of 588 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 31 papers in Control and Systems Engineering, 29 papers in Information Systems and 25 papers in Safety, Risk, Reliability and Quality. Recurrent topics in Ricardo Valerdi’s work include Systems Engineering Methodologies and Applications (31 papers), Technology Assessment and Management (24 papers) and Software Engineering Techniques and Practices (22 papers). Ricardo Valerdi is often cited by papers focused on Systems Engineering Methodologies and Applications (31 papers), Technology Assessment and Management (24 papers) and Software Engineering Techniques and Practices (22 papers). Ricardo Valerdi collaborates with scholars based in United States, Sweden and United Kingdom. Ricardo Valerdi's co-authors include Barry Boehm, Jo Ann Lane, Donna H. Rhodes, Wang Gan and Lorraine Morgan and has published in prestigious journals such as Computer, Information and Software Technology and IEEE Software.
